In any case, the Suburban Striders Running Club is made up of women runners of all abilities primarily from the Metrowest Boston area. The women in the group have a wide variety of goals, from racing/running long distances to just wanting to be part of a group to only run and not race. Or just avoid their children, No, just kidding. If you are “a runner” or have always wanted to be one so that you can spend lots of money on Sauconys and physical therapy, oh and you’re a woman, think about heading out for a trial session.

The club normally meets on Wednesday mornings from 9-10 am at the Wellesley High School track for coached workouts. During the winter (January-March) workouts are at the Babson College indoor track on most Wednesdays from 8:30-10:30 am.
